SJR 108 - If approved by the voters, this constitutional amendment requires the Department of Social Services and the MO HealthNet Division to implement work requirements for certain individuals as a condition of participation in the MO HealthNet program. These individuals shall demonstrate compliance with work requirements for 3 consecutive months immediately preceding the month during which they apply and the Department and Division shall disenroll any individual who fails to comply with work requirements. The Department shall submit any necessary state plan amendments to implement this amendment to the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services no later than March 1, 2027. This constitutional amendment is similar to SJR 103 (2026), SCS/SJR 43 (2025), SJR 76 (2024), provisions of SJR 4 (2023) and HCS/HJR 117 (2022), SJR 60 (2020), and SJR 32 (2020). SARAH HASKINS
